BASIL, SNAP PEA AND RICE SALAD WITH CREAMY YOGURT DRESSING

Provided by Molly O'Neill

Categories     easy, quick, salads and dressings

Time 15m

Yield Six servings

Number Of Ingredients 22



Basil, Snap Pea And Rice Salad With Creamy Yogurt Dressing image

Steps:

  • Blanch sugar snaps in boiling salted water until crisp-tender, about 4 minutes. Drain, refresh under cold running water, drain and pat dry. Place in a bowl and toss with the olive oil, the salt and pepper.
  • Place the rice in a bowl and toss in the basil, lime juice, 1 teaspoon of salt and pepper.
  • Place the cucumbers in a bowl and toss with the lemon juice, salt and mint.
  • Place the salad greens in a large bowl and toss with the basil. Whisk together the yogurt, milk, olive oil, garlic, salt and pepper to taste. Stir in the scallions and place in a small bowl. Pass the dishes separately, letting guests build their own salads.

1 1/4 pounds sugar snap peas, strung
2 1/2 teaspoons olive oil
1 teaspoon kosher salt
Freshly ground pepper to taste
3 cups cooked white rice
1/2 cup thinly sliced fresh basil
2 teaspoons fresh lime juice
1 teaspoon kosher salt
Freshly ground pepper to taste
6 medium cucumbers, peeled, halved lengthwise, seeded and cut across into 1/4-inch slices
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
1 teaspoon kosher salt
6 tablespoons coarsely chopped fresh mint
10 cups salad greens
2 cups torn basil
1 cup plain lowfat yogurt
1 tablespoon milk
4 teaspoons olive oil
1 small clove garlic, peeled and minced
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t, plus more to taste
Freshly ground pepper to taste
2 scallions, minced

SUGAR SNAP PEAS WITH YOGURT, FETA AND DILL

Much of the appeal of sugar snap peas comes from their juicy, sweet crunch, which means you'll want to take care when blanching them. They turn from perfectly crisp-tender to soft in seconds. The key is to have a bowl of salted ice water next to the stove and a slotted spoon at the ready. The salt in the ice water seasons the peas, and the ice stops them from overcooking. In this savory salad, they're tossed with a garlicky dressing for brightness, and a creamy feta-yogurt sauce for richness. Serve them with crusty bread as a summery appetizer, or as a side dish for grilled fish or meats.

Provided by Melissa Clark

Categories     dinner, lunch, salads and dressings, vegetables, main course

Time 20m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14



Sugar Snap Peas With Yogurt, Feta and Dill image

Steps:

  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Have ready a bowl of well-salted ice water and a slotted spoon next to the stove. Drop peas into boiling water and cook until crisp-tender, about 1 minute. Use the spoon to transfer peas to ice water to cool completely. Drain well and pat dry with a clean kitchen towel.
  • When cool enough to handle, put the peas on a cutting board and slice them in half, crosswise.
  • In a medium bowl, whisk together garlic and lemon juice. Stir in salt and pepper. Whisk in 3 tablespoons olive oil. Add the halved peas, fennel, dill and scallions, and toss well. Taste and add more lemon juice, olive oil or salt if needed.
  • In a small bowl, stir together the yogurt, 1/4 cup feta, lemon zest, and the remaining 1 tablespoon oil. Season with salt, pepper and lemon juice, to taste.
  • Spread the yogurt on a serving platter, and spoon the peas on top. Scatter remaining 1/4 cup feta on top, drizzle with more oil, and top with herbs. Serve as a side dish or scooped onto crusty bread as an appetizer.

1/4 teaspoon kosher salt, plus more for water and to taste
1/2 pound sugar snap peas, trimmed (about 3 cups)
1 garlic clove, finely grated or minced
1 1/2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ice, plus more to taste
Freshly ground black pepper
4 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, plus more for drizzling
1 cup thinly sliced fennel, or use radish or cucumber
1/2 packed cup roughly chopped fresh dill, or use a combination of dill and fennel fronds
2 scallions, thinly sliced
1/3 cup plain whole-milk yogurt (if using Greek, thin it down with milk or water until pourable)
1/2 cup crumbled feta (about 2 ounces)
1/2 teaspoon finely grated lemon zest
Torn soft herbs, such as mint, basil, parsley, tarragon, chives, cilantro or a combination, for serving
Crusty bread, for serving (optional)

CREAMY BASIL DRESSING

Provided by Jesus Gonzalez

Categories     Blender     Food Processor     Citrus     Garlic     Herb     Onion     No-Cook     Vegetarian     Yogurt     Salad Dressing

Yield Makes about 3/4 cup (about 12 servings)

Number Of Ingredients 8



Creamy Basil Dressing image

Steps:

  • In blender or food processor, combine yogurt, vinegar, lemon juice, chopped basil, shallots, garlic, salt, and pepper and pureé until very smooth, 1 to 2 minutes.
  • Stir in sliced basil and serve.

1/2 cup plain low fat or non-fat yogurt
2 tablespoons white balsamic vinegar
1 tablespoon freshly squeezed lemon juice
2 tablespoons fresh basil leaves, roughly chopped plus 2 tablespoons sliced lengthwise into 1/4-inch strips
3/4 teaspoon shallots, chopped (about 1/4 small shallot)
1/4 teaspoon garlic, chopped (about 1/2 clove)
1/8 teaspoon sea salt
1/8 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
